Hi Fishes! Does anyone have a not too expensive alternative to Becker for CPA prep? I’m studying for FAR, but Becker is making me highlight the whole textbook and the concepts are just so heavy lol. I’ve heard of i75, Ninja, and Farhat lectures - does anyone have any feedback on them? Thank you guys!

I really like Surgent. I felt well prepared for FAR. I think it was about half the price of Becker.

I used Ninja for FAR (haven’t gotten scores back so can’t determine how efficient it was) but I didn’t like how they do simulations. It was nice to have another outlet for MCQs but overall don’t think I’d subscribe again for another section. I feel like I got a lot of help from people on YouTube explaining concepts.
